For example, 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 can be written as 2 4, as 2 is multiplied by itself 4 times. What is the exponential form of 343? Here, 2 is called the 'base' and 4 is called the 'exponent' or 'power'. For example, five to the sixth power is in exponent form, and the standard form of this exponent is 15,625. When the exponent form is five to the sixth power and the standard form is 15,625, the expanded form is 5x5x5x5x5x5.
